Political Turmoil Hitting Both Parties In Himachal

The Congress seems eternally embroiled in one conflict or the other. Recently both factions of Chief Minister and Himachal Pradesh Congress Committee (HPCC) president had finished their arsenal in the presence of state party affairs in charge Sushil Kumar Shinde. Shinde had come to bring unity amongst Congress leaders but left reportedly without any gains.

In the meantime there is internal fireworks time and again. Latest storm in the tea cup was Vidya Stokes’s gussa on transfer of her Horticulture Secretary without her consent. She was so upset with Chief Minister on this transgression of protocol that she reportedly threatened to boycott attending the session. She is senior most Congress leader and this was bound to create a very embarrassing situation which would have given enough fodder to the opposition, political observers point out.

When she did not reach the assembly, many intermediary worked to run between Virbhadra Singh and her. Ultimately Chief Minister agreed to withdraw the transfer and that placated her to come for the session. There were reportedly angry exchange of words between the two but later the situation cooled down. Such skirmishes show that party is brittle and no sign of unity infused by Shinde is visible, political observers add.

In our survey also it seemed that there is virtually a vacillating public opinion about the future leader of the party as only 52% have voted for Virbhadra to lead the party in election. Although it is still majority of votes in the opinions, yet the normal guess that he would get massive majority has turned a vain hope.

Assembly session has gone waste with so many walkouts and delay in conducting the legislature business. In fact there is high time to consider how to save legislature’s time and money on conducting precious business by restraining the quantum of protest hours.

The BJP too is facing cold war and there has been a spate of letters from Anurag Thakur to claim credit in founding of the AIIMS type institution which J.P. Nadda seems to take it in his fold, both as Central minister and leader of Bilaspur where the location is being established.
